Sonic Unleashed Confusion
News Update: 11/20/08

While Sonic Unleashed, in North America, for the PlayStation 2 and the Nintendo Wii has already been released; there is confusion amongst retail stores for the P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 versions. Although stores like GameStop and EB Games have the Xbox 360 version of Sonic Unleashed in stock, some are more willing than others to relinquish the game to customers. To help those who are still confused over the release dates I'll list them for you.
Release Dates
Nintendo Wii and Sony PlayStation 2
November 18th, 2008
Microsoft Xbox 360
November 24, 2008
Sony PlayStation 3
December 12, 2008
There are some retail stores like Best Buy and a few GameStops that are willing to release the Xbox 360 version tomorrow, so it's best to make a few phone calls before setting off on your journey.
Delays for Sonic World Adventure
News Update: 11/10/08

While Sonic Unleashed appears to be releasing in eight days for North America, the game for both the Xbox 360 and PS3 has been delayed until possibly the spring of 2009 for Japan. According to Sonic Channel's staff member Moro, "in order to enrich the content and software quality [of the game]...," the original retail schedule of December 18th, 2008 has been postponed and a confirmed released date for the Xbox 360 and PS3 is unknown at the moment. As for the Wii edition, there won't be any modifications and will release on time (December 18th, 2008).

Sonic's Ultimate Genesis Collection
News Update: 11/06/08

Today SEGA announced their largest first party collection pack for the Xbox 360 and the PlayStation 3 Entertainment System to date. Relive SEGA's 16-bit and 8-bit golden years in an enhanced experience (for me 1080i is Hi-Def not 720p) for a retail price of $29.95. This collection will include over 40 favorite titles, with offline multiplayer options, that will surly bring back memories. Just like many of SEGA's collection titles, there will be unlockable content giving you the chance to earn achievements (Xbox 360) or trophies (PS3) while unlocking arcade games and interviews with the original game developers.
